South Korea Acrylic Acid Market Overview & Growth Outlook
The South Korea acrylic acid market was valued at approximately USD 1.2 billion in 2023 and is projected to reach USD 1.8 billion by 2032, growing at a compound annual growth rate (CAGR) of around 4.5%. This steady expansion reflects the country’s increasing demand for acrylic acid in various end-use industries, including construction, automotive, and consumer goods. The market’s growth trajectory is supported by technological advancements and expanding domestic manufacturing capacities.
